dc.description.abstractOptimization techniques based on mathematical programming algorithms are powerful tools, capable of providing solutions to the problems which engineers and planners face while planning and remodelling of complex water resources systems. The scope of, optimal solutions cover well beyond the conventional failures and inturn the national perspective planning get disturbed, when the farmers are not guided by the operational techniques leading to a financially viable project, dissatisfaction and abondment is the ultimate result. The study deals with the use of linear programming model and simulation model on Anjunem reservoir project of Goa. The linear programming model is applied to idetify optimal crop planning for the project area. Further screening is carried out by simulation for 20 years monthly flow data. Best solutions is identified on the basis of benefit, socio-economic considerations and satisfying the norms i.e. 90 percent success on annual energy generation and 75 percent success on annual irrigation.. iiien_US
